Case IH CVT technology

One of the more popular exhibits at the Farm Progress Show is the Case IH CVT tent. CVT stands for continuously variable transmission. Visitors to the exhibit have the opportunity to sit in a cut-away version of a cab seat and actually operate the tractor. There is also a CVT simulator shows the “guts” of the CVT.Dave Bogan, Marketing Manager for the Maximum Puma Line for the CaseIH line of tractors, explains the CVT is simple to use, even with minimal training, because there’s no programming required or complicated settings to change. The Case IH continuously variable transmission (CVT), is now available on Case IH MagnumTM180, 190, 210 and the new 225 tractors, delivers more.

The Case IH CVT technology automatically adjusts to deliver the best possible balance of power and fuel efficiency.  Bogan tells Brownfield that it brings a lot to the industry in ease of operation and productivity management.
